Abstract :
An alternative derivation is presented of a QR-type algorithm for near-to-Toeplitz matrices that arise in linear prediction, where the data matrix is arbitrarily windowed. The algorithm generalizes a result due to C.P. Rialan and L.L. Scharf (1988) and the derivation followed is believed to be more transparent than an equivalent result due to C.J. Demeure and L.L. Scharf (1987)
